Job Description
Summary
This is a Direct Hire Authority (DHA) solicitation utilizing the DHA for Certain DoD Personnel to recruit and appoint qualified candidates to positions in the competitive service.
About the Position: As a Tying Tool Repairer with the Mat Sinking Unit you will repair automatic tying tools used in the construction of articulated concrete mattresses.
-The duty location of this position will be wherever the Mat Sinking Unit is located.
-This position is full time, permanent, seasonal position.

Minimum Qualifications (Screen Out Element): Ability to do the work of a(n) Tying Tool Repairer without more than normal supervision. Duties include: Performing a full range of repairs to automatic tying tools used in revetment operations and diagnose problems associated with the tying tools. - Failure to meet this Screen Out Element will result in an ineligible rating.
- Physical Effort: Work assignments require the incumbent to stand most of the time, sit some of the time, stoop occasionally and to occasionally use tiring positions. Intermittent physical activity is exerted in manipulating hand tools and occasionally handling the semi-automatic tying tool weighing approximately 40 pounds.
- Working Conditions: Incumbent normally performs repairs, adjustments and maintenance in a work room separated from the mat boat operations. This work area has adequate ventilation and odors, fumes and smoke are of little significance. Normal noise conditions are such that they can be readily talked above. Dirt or grease conditions inherent in this repair work are frequently disagreeable.
